Guidance tracker
Management expects the DNPL-IGGL linkage to be completed by end of Q3 FY26, with offtake improvement from Q4 FY26 and full operation by Q1 FY27.
Management targets net production of at least 6,000 barrels of oil equivalent per day by FY27, driven by drilling and grid connectivity.
Company secured a ₹250 crore term loan exclusively for capital expenditure, primarily for offshore drilling.
Plans to drill 18 shallow wells and 3 deep wells in Kasang block, with 7 wells already drilled in the initial phase.
Management targets reaching 10,000-11,000 barrels of oil equivalent per day by June 2027, driven by workovers at B80, new wells at PY1, and drilling at Dirok and Kasang.
Dirok field has the potential to produce 45 million standard cubic feet per day once pipeline connectivity is restored, up from current 0.3-0.4 mmscmd.
Kasang production is expected to double from current ~700 bbl/d gross through a nine-well drilling campaign, following a previous doubling from the first nine wells.
Management plans to fund the capex program through internal cash generation and bank facilities, with no immediate equity dilution plans.
